Output 76dac430dc6425e2f41cb5966cf5f28b51aa7c5ed0600e0ada176aa142ef0df3:0

value
301598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8228de9651a276dea2565c62214a524e5d2bff4e OP_EQUAL
address
3DZEj9FTBvs7zXWe1gBx1ou1E4haA25Ekz
transaction
76dac430dc6425e2f41cb5966cf5f28b51aa7c5ed0600e0ada176aa142ef0df3
spent
true